The Federal Court published new evidence in the ACCC’s case against Woolworths over its “Prices Dropped” campaign, alleging the retailer misled shoppers on 266 products by temporarily raising prices before advertising discounts. Woolworths denies wrongdoing, arguing its signage was accurate. The case file was updated April 24. Woolworths’ MILKRUN brand will give away 20,000 grocery items from April 29 to May 2.

Bank of Queensland (ASX: BOQ) shares trade around $6.27 amid strong investor interest in ASX bank stocks, which compose about one-third of the Australian market by capitalization. Two straightforward valuation approaches include the Price-Earnings (PE) ratio and the Dividend Discount Model (DDM). BOQ's PE ratio stands at 15.3x, below the banking sector average of 18x, suggesting potential undervaluation. The sector-adjusted PE valuation points to a share price near $7.44. The DDM uses consistent bank dividends, factoring in expected dividend growth and risk rate assumptions, offering a robust, alternative valuation method. Investors are advised to combine these methods for a balanced perspective on BOQ's value.
